Barris's credits, for the record, include Back to the Future's DeLorean, the A-Team van, and Knight Rider's Kitt.
"I wasn't really aware of Batman before making the car," he says. "I knew the comic books, I guess, but had no idea it was going to turn into such a big thing. I had three weeks to conceptualize and build it. The only idea they had was to cut out a bat face and stick it on the front of a Lincoln. Ridiculous!"
Explains the article, "Barris had a long-standing relationship with Ford and owned a concept car called the Lincoln Futura — an outlandishly long, bubble-windowed coupe hand-built in Italy. It became the base."
